HAVANA, CUBA.- The Russian cruise ship Adriana, of the Tropicana Cruises LTD company, will soon begin a regular circumnavigation tour around Cuba under the name “Knowing Cuba from the Sea”. The director of International Sales Development of the Cubatur travel agency, Juan Carlos Escalona, said the circuit will begin on December 25 and it will be similar to the first circumnavigation around the Caribbean island in 1509 by Spanish Sebastian de Ocampo. Cuban Vice Foreign Minister Marcos Rodriguez Costa and Kiribati Foreign Minister Tessie Eria Lambourne signed an agreement Tuesday to boost bilateral cooperation. Kiribati President Anote Tong and his delegation are officially visiting the Caribbean island country. Read More
